The size of Taree is approximately 47.8 square kilometres. It has 44 parks covering nearly 5.7% of total area. The population of Taree in 2016 was 16197 people. By 2021 the population was 16715 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Taree is 60-69 years. Households in Taree are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Taree work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 58.70% of the homes in Taree were owner-occupied compared with 58.50% in 2016.
Taree has 9,694 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Taree have seen a 55.18%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 55.28% increase. As at 31 January 2026:
